Trump officials say AI will help save rural health care. Some leaders in the field don’t believe it

BANGOR, Maine — Rural health care providers, which have struggled for years, are facing nearly $1 trillion in Medicaid cuts over the coming decade. The Trump administration is pointing to a cutting-edge, if unproven way to save them: artificial intelligence.

“The best way to help” rural communities, is “AI-based avatars,” Mehmet Oz, who leads the Centers for Medicare and Medicaid Services, said at an event on mental health this year.

His comments are among the grand promises administration officials have made about AI. They’ve also touted the prospect of concierge care for every American and AI nurses as good as any doctor, for example. Their argument is that AI, fueled by the $50 billion rural health transformation fund that came along with the Medicaid cuts, could remake rural care in the U.S. 

The technology could lower the cost of delivering care, Oz has said, and could be a deflationary force across the health care economy.

But providers serving rural communities aren’t so sure.

“I don’t think AI is going to make health care costs go down in the near term at all,” said Lori Dwyer, president and CEO of Penobscot Community Health Care, a system that stretches across Maine. “I don’t think it’s going to save us.”

Her system has already started using ambient scribes, an AI technology that listens to a clinician’s conversation with a patient and then helps document it in the electronic health record. While that’s had plenty of benefits, saving money isn’t one of them, Dwyer said.

“It’s allowed us to off-load work, administrative burdens from our providers and our care teams so that they can focus on patients and patient care and so that they don’t burn out,” she said, adding that documentation time is down, and communications are improved. “But that doesn’t reduce costs.”

Other ways the system is using AI, such as for patient communications or to aid in remote patient monitoring, have been helpful, she said — but only create marginal economic efficiencies at a time when years of work to stabilize the system’s finances is essentially being wiped out by the looming cuts.


A troubling reality on AI

Across dozens of interviews with rural health providers, hospital system leaders, and health AI experts, a troubling reality was repeated: Investing in AI technology would be costly, especially for already at-risk systems, and its savings potential hasn’t yet been proved. Despite the tools holding promise, they’re expensive — and buyers are facing a wave of new financial pressures.

Rural health system leaders are excited about the technology’s potential in the distant future and feel the need to invest in it in order to keep up with the nationwide advancement. 

But the large-scale, system-altering changes that promise huge savings and a fundamental shift in health care delivery seem well out of reach for many rural health systems. 

Health AI leaders and rural health providers alike are concerned those gains will go largely to the big systems with money to invest in AI-native infrastructure — a costly, time-consuming endeavor. In the end, the technology could increase health inequities in the U.S. instead of shrinking them, they worry.

Despite the challenges, some rural health leaders see adopting AI technology as their only way forward in an exceedingly difficult environment. 

A few system leaders told STAT they’re accelerating their adoption of AI tools — because of the cuts — even beyond what they were doing at the start of the ChatGPT age. Finding new efficiencies has become a mandatory task, and more than 70% of hospitals are estimated to be using predictive AI, according to one survey, and companies that create electronic health records software are grappling with how to make the most of the technology.

“We’re accelerating it probably faster than I thought we would,” said Trampas Hutches, the Mountain Region president at MaineHealth, who noted the technology was one of the top priorities in MaineHealth’s three-year plan. “The only way to meet the demand is technology and AI.”

Hutches said the system is in the process of making AI a “care team member,” as well as using the technology for ambient notetaking and in administrative work.

“We’re really trying to push the envelope on acceptance of AI as a care team,” he said, though he added that the cost of the technology is a concern. “We’re doing everything we can to make sure our cost structure does not go any higher than it is today.”

AI’s rural limits

Medical technology doesn’t have to be on the cutting edge to come up against challenges in rural America. Telehealth, for instance, which often uses tech from a decade ago or more, still has trouble getting traction in remote areas at times, because internet infrastructure can be weak or missing — or because the regulatory and payment structures are still unsettled.

AI faces those problems — and more. 

Low access to broadband in Maine, for example, could keep internet-dependent systems from being reliable, said hospital leaders in the state. Others may not have the data infrastructure needed to take advantage of new systems: Forms that are faxed or handwritten aren’t always easily entered into digital systems.

Even some digitized systems aren’t easily or reliably digestible by AI systems. Even advanced hospital systems have had to undergo lengthy, tedious reorganizations to prepare for the technology.

“If you’re employed by a big health system, you’re much more likely to have that opportunity,” James Jarvis, president of the Maine Medical Association, said of the new technology. “If you’re at a private practice, you’re much less likely to have that advantage.”

Many rural providers — including those trying to accelerate their adoption of the technology — are finding it difficult to figure out which AI products are worthwhile.

“There’s a lot of garbage out there,” said James McHugh, a managing director at Berkeley Research Group who focuses on health technology and automation and helps clients implement the technology. Many AI implementations in health care haven’t gone particularly well so far, and adoption has taken substantial resources, he said.

Many system leaders look to invest in AI in the hopes that it will lower their labor costs, but that “usually doesn’t happen,” he said. There’s potential for it in the future, he added, but it’s not as simple as the grand claims being touted by AI vendors and administration officials.

The calculus for hospitals goes beyond just whether the tech that vendors are selling will actually improve their bottom line. It also includes whether the tools are safe for patient data and care.

“There are so many out there,” Hutches, who works at a relatively well-resourced system, said of the tools being sold, comparing it to the dot-com bubble. “You don’t know where to go.”

Small practices and clinics, especially those in the middle of a struggle to stay afloat, may have an even harder time landing on the right adoption strategy or finding the cash to invest.

“It still creates inequities for sure, as does the education and ability to use the tools themselves,” Dwyer said.

Even so, some AI vendors have reported expansion in rural areas. Aidoc, a radiology AI company, has seen “definitive growth” in more remote areas, Jesse Ehrenfeld, chief medical officer at the company and past president of the American Medical Association, told STAT.

“As you’d expect, a lot of those places are not well resourced: They don’t have AI governance in place, they don’t have the bandwidth to do deployment at scale,” he said. “It looks very different.”

Ehrenfeld said he sees a future where Aidoc’s technology can make sense of patient imaging to help under-resourced systems figure out how to deploy clinicians and medical transportation. But for now, rural leaders say fundamental issues of financial sustainability will have to be solved before an AI-powered medical system can come to many Americans.

“If you’re technology challenged,” Jarvis said, “it doesn’t help that someone comes up with a technology-based solution.”
